蛋白核小球藻在废水污泥中培养的研究

摘    要:啤酒厂废水污泥中含有一定的营养元素和活性物质。本研究利用废水污泥培养蛋白核小球藻(Chlorellapyrenoidosa)取得了初步结果。将一定比例的活性污泥掺入普通培养液形成混合培养基,其中80:20试验组无论从蛋白核小球藻的生物量还是粗蛋白的含量均与普通培养基的培养产物近似,具有实践意义。结果表明,混合培养基培养某些藻类,不仅降低了养殖成本,还可净化环境,为废水污泥用于藻类养殖开辟了一条新途径。

STUDIES ON THE CULTURE OF CHLORELLA PYRENOIDOSA WITH WASTE WATER SLUDGE

Abstract:In nowadays extensive studies of algae have been carrying out on their biological characteristics, collection and the utilization of their protein, One of the existing problems is the high cost of medium and low economic gain.However, brewery studge contains 20-30% raw protein, some microelements and elements of large quantity such as P, Fe and K. These elements are necessary for the growth of the alga, Experimental results showed that the yield of chlorella pyrenoidsa was almost the same sfter cultivation in the medium with a substilution of waste water sludge for 80% of the previous medium.Obviously the use of waste water sludge of alge cultivation not only helps clean the environment but also lowers the cultivating cost therefore this is an effective way for the waste water sludge treatment and increasing the scale of the alcultivation.
